This photograph by Romualdo Moscioni, taken between 1868 and 1900, captures a detail of the Villa Madama in Rome. The image focuses on the cornice, a decorative element that runs along the top of the building. The intricate carvings and the subtle shadows create a sense of depth and texture, highlighting the architectural beauty of this Renaissance masterpiece. Villa Madama, designed by Raphael, is a prime example of Italian High Renaissance architecture, and this photograph offers a glimpse into the building's exquisite details.
